Output 3649bc8ef12efcf36dee62d4b7a2e28de1c3feb0ad46c71d3ba72bd760f95a7a:1

value
1576760
script pubkey
OP_0 OP_PUSHBYTES_20 c5ac58642e56a126c6fbc52fee2ef5eaf17c1154
address
ltc1qckk9sepw26sjd3hmc5h7uth4atchcy2560uakf
transaction
3649bc8ef12efcf36dee62d4b7a2e28de1c3feb0ad46c71d3ba72bd760f95a7a
spent
true